Indirectly, kinda yes, using auction house. They go to auction house and start searching for offers by your gamertag. You drop car at minimum price, cross fingers, and if your buddy is fast enough he will buyout car before someone else does.
If you want to send him money back (for example he bought car that can't be listed for less than 2mil), he lists some normal car at outrageous price, and you buy it from him. My fav for this is BMW M3 2008, costs 48k but can be listed all way to 12mil).
Note that some cash is lost in every transaction.
